Summary Note |
"[T]his newly revised edition offers unique ways to bridge the digital divide that disproportionally affects culturally and linguistically diverse learners. Designed to support equitable access to engaging and enriching digital-age education opportunities for English learners, this book includes: Research-informed and evidence-based technology integration models and instructional strategies; Sample lesson ideas, including learning targets for activating students prior knowledge while promoting engagement and collaboration; Tips for fostering collaborative practices with colleagues; Vignettes from educators incorporating technology in creative ways; Targeted questions to facilitate discussions about English language development methodology." - Back cover. |
